  • Patent number: 6907302
    Abstract: A system and software for controlling output devices used in association with machinery is disclosed. The system includes a control module which may be connected to a personal digital assistant (PDA), personal pocket PC, personal computer, organizer, cell phone, or other data storage device. The data storage device has programmed within it particularized manufacturer information for various input devices and output devices available on the market. The system allows an operator to select a particular manufacturer, as well as product information, including product model number and operating parameters. The machine can then be calibrated such that the input device being used, as well as the output device manufacturer information, is used to dynamically adjust, monitor or perform diagnostics on the machine. The system allows for on-site calibration of the machine controllers.

  • Patent number: 6368016
    Abstract: A self-propelled concrete finishing trowel has a power steering control system that steers the machine by tilting the driven shaft(s) of the rotor assembly or assemblies of the machine without requiring the imposition of fatiguing actuating forces by the machine's operator. The steering control system includes at least one electric actuator, such as a ball screw actuator, coupled to each rotor assembly of the machine and controlled by an operator-manipulated controller. The controller preferably includes at least one, and possibly two, joysticks that can be manipulated by the operator to steer the machine in the direction of joystick motion and preferably at a speed that is proportional to the magnitude of joystick movement. In the typical case in which the machine is steered by pivoting a gearbox of at least one rotor assembly about two axes, a separate actuator is provided for each axis of gearbox pivoting.

  • Patent number: 5389752
    Abstract: A control lever is provided for actuating a deadman's switch or any other switch actuatable by a lever. The control lever is resilient and includes a base portion fixed to the support on which the switch is mounted and an actuator portion which is formed integral with the base portion and which extends over the switch. The actuator portion is deflectable into contact with the switch without the interaction of any pivot element, hinge, or any other connection of the control lever to the support. The lever can be easily actuated with any portion of the operator's hand and preferably is sufficiently resilient to prevent the function of the switch from being defeated by the insertion of a facing object between the lever and the switch and to prevent or at least inhibit damage to the switch due to overpressure on the lever. The lever is preferably pliable and thus can be bent or twisted in virtually any direction without damaging the lever.

  • Patent number: 5293900
    Abstract: A direct drive joystick has a contactless system for sensing the position of the joystick lever and having valve drivers which are positioned within the joystick, and which are directly connected to coils of a proportional valve. The joystick thus is not prone to failure due to internal friction of its sensing elements and at the same time is capable of directly driving valves without the provision of any other devices between the joystick and the valves. The joystick including the valve driver is rugged, compact and can be easily installed. The valve driver can be adjusted by an operator who is simultaneously actuating the joystick. The operational status of one or more of the joystick, the valve being controlled by the joystick, and the power source for the valve and joystick are visually displayed at a location which can be easily viewed by the joystick operator. Operation of the valve driver and thus of the joystick is prevented upon failure of a signal wire or upon generation of a joystick fault signal.
